Working Principle:
A pendulum hammer with known energy strikes the sample supported on
a horizontal beam, destroying the sample with a single impact. The
impact point is centered between the two supports. By calculating
the energy difference of the pendulum before and after impact, the
energy absorbed by the sample during destruction is determined. The
impact strength is then calculated based on the original
cross-sectional area of the sample.
Meet standards:
ISO179-2000, ASTM D 6110, GB/T1043-2008, JB/T8762-1998, GB/T 18743-2002

Specimen Type Table for Charpy Impact:
Unit: mm
| Specimen type | Length (L) | Width (Y) | Thickness(X) | Span between supporting points(b) |
| 1 | 80±2 | 10±0.5 | 4±0.2 | 60 |
| 2 | 50±1 | 6±0.5 | 4±0.2 | 40 |
| 3 | 120±2 | 15±0.5 | 10±0.5 | 70 |
| 4 | 125±2 | 13±0.5 | 13±0.5 | 95 |
